Sobald die Erweiterung (SOE oder SOI) bereitgestellt wird, können Sie sie in Ihren gewünschten Services aktivieren. Dazu verwenden Sie ArcGIS Server Manager, wobei der Prozess unabhängig davon, ob Sie das ArcGIS Enterprise SDK oder eines der ArcObjects SDKs verwenden, identisch ist.
SOEs und SOIs, die mit dem ArcGIS Enterprise SDK entwickelt wurden, können nur in Kartenservices (einschließlich der Erweiterungen, wie zum Beispiel Feature-Services und OGC-konforme Kartenservices) aktiviert werden. SOEs und SOIs, die mit einem ArcObjects SDK entwickelt wurden, können in Karten- oder Image-Services (einschließlich aller Erweiterungen von Services dieser zwei Typen) aktiviert werden.
Aktivieren von SOE
Sie können eine oder mehrere SOEs für einen Service aktivieren.
- Melden Sie sich bei ArcGIS Server Manager an und navigieren Sie zu Ihrem Service.
- Klicken Sie auf den Namen des Service, der ein Hyperlink ist.
- Klicken Sie auf Funktionen, und aktivieren Sie das Kontrollkästchen neben dem Namen der SOE, die Sie für den Service aktivieren möchten.
- Wählen Sie ggf. die Vorgänge aus, die Sie für die SOE zulassen möchten. Diese Operationen wurden optional vom Entwickler der Erweiterung erstellt und geben Ihnen eine genauere Kontrolle darüber, was die Benutzer mit der SOE durchführen können.
- Legen Sie alle weiteren Eigenschaften für die SOE fest, die auf dieser Eigenschaftenseite angezeigt werden. Die Eigenschaften der SOE sind durch mehrere Eingabefelder konfigurierbar, es sei denn, der Entwickler der Erweiterung hat ausgewählt, die Eigenschaftenseite anzupassen.
- Um Ihre Änderungen zu speichern, klicken Sie auf Speichern und neu starten. Der Service wird neu gestartet, wenn Sie speichern.
Aktivieren von SOI
Sie können einen oder mehrere SOIs für einen Service aktivieren. Die Aktivierung mehrerer SOIs wird als Verkettung bezeichnet. Beim Verketten müssen Sie die Reihenfolge festlegen, in der die SOIs im Service ausgeführt werden.
Ältere Versionen:
Vor 10.4 konnte nur ein SOI für einen Service aktiviert werden. Jetzt können Sie mehrere SOIs verketten und die Reihenfolge ihrer Ausführung festlegen.
- Melden Sie sich bei ArcGIS Server Manager an und navigieren Sie zu Ihrem Service.
- Klicken Sie auf den Namen des Service, der ein Hyperlink ist.
- Klicken Sie auf Funktionen.
- Wählen Sie in der Liste der verfügbaren Interceptoren die SOIs aus, die Sie aktivieren möchten, und klicken Sie auf den Nach-rechts-Pfeil. Dadurch werden sie der Liste der aktivierten SOIs hinzugefügt.
- Wenn Sie mehrere SOIs für den Service aktiviert haben, legen Sie die Reihenfolge, in der die SOIs in der Kette ausgeführt werden, anhand der Nach-rechts- und Nach-unten-Pfeile fest. Der SOI ganz oben in der Liste wird zuerst ausgeführt, gefolgt von dem zweiten Element in der Liste usw., bis zum Ende der Liste.
Tipp:
Sie können jederzeit zu diesem Dialogfeld zurückkehren, um die Liste der aktivierten SOIs und die Reihenfolge ihrer Ausführung in der Kette zu ändern.
- Klicken Sie auf Speichern.
- Wählen Sie ggf. die Vorgänge aus, die Sie für die SOIs zulassen möchten. Diese Operationen wurden optional vom Entwickler der Erweiterung erstellt und geben Ihnen eine genauere Kontrolle darüber, was die Benutzer mit den SOIs durchführen können.
- Legen Sie alle weiteren Eigenschaften für die SOIs fest, die auf dieser Eigenschaftenseite angezeigt werden. Die Eigenschaften der SOIs sind durch mehrere Eingabefelder konfigurierbar, es sei denn, der Entwickler der Erweiterung hat ausgewählt, die Eigenschaftenseite anzupassen.
- Um Ihre Änderungen zu speichern, klicken Sie auf Speichern und neu starten. Der Service wird neu gestartet, wenn Sie speichern.